A complete guide to understanding, treating, and living with thyroid disease, from Harvard Medical School
More than 13 million people in the United States suffer from some form of thyroid disease, and that number is expected to rise precipitously as the baby boomer generation approaches its sixties.
Written by an internationally respected authority on thyroid disease, Dr. Jeffrey R. Garber, The Harvard Medical School Guide to Overcoming Thyroid Problems is an up-to-the minute, authoritative source of practical information for thyroid patients and those who think they may have a thyroid problem. About the Author:
Jeffrey R. Garber, M.D., is an assistant clinical professor at Harvard Medical School and chief of endocrinology at Harvard Vanguard Medical Associates, a Harvard-affiliated independent practice. He is affiliated with both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center and Brigham and Women's Hospital, two world-renowned Harvard teaching hospitals, and he is a director on the executive council of the American Thyroid Association.
Sandra Sardella White is an award-winning freelance health writer and coauthor of The Children's Hospital Guide to Your Child's Health and Development.
